JOB PURPOSE:
We are seeking an experienced and highly skilled Safety, Health, and Environment Auditor (Line of Defence 2) to join our team. The successful candidate will be responsible for auditing compliance with SHE standards across UL sites, including factories, distribution centres, offices, and R&D facilities. This role requires extensive travel with colleagues and expertise in SHE standards to ensure our sites meet the highest levels of compliance and UL’s market leading commitments to Safety, Health and the Environment are realised.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Prepare and agree the SHE audit plan
Lead comprehensive SHE audits at various company sites globally.
Evaluate compliance with internal and external SHE standards and regulations.
Identify areas of non-compliance and provide actionable recommendations for improvement.
Prepare detailed audit reports and present findings to senior management.
Summarise themes from the individual audits to look for systemic gaps and present to senior leaders.
Collaborate with site management to develop and implement corrective action plans.
Monitor the effectiveness of corrective actions and ensure continuous improvement.
Stay updated on the latest internal and external SHE standards and regulations and best practices.
Design and deploy an efficient and effective internal (Line of Defence 2) Audit programme which is continuously improved.
WHAT YOU NEED TO SUCCEED:
Required Skills and Competencies:
Technical Expertise:
In-depth knowledge of SHE standards (e.g Process Safety, Environmental compliance and Occupational Health and safety Management) and regulations. This includes global and local regulations relevant to the audited sites.
Experience with SHE auditing processes and methodologies and overall UL Audit programme.
Ability to interpret and apply complex regulatory requirements and how they apply to specific site operations
Specialist technical experience in Process Safety or Environmental or Industrial Hygiene is essential.
Analytical Skills:
Ability to comprehend and synthesise a site risk profile
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ities.
Attention to detail and ability to identify potential risks and non-compliance issues.
Communication Skills:
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
Ability to prepare clear and concise audit reports.
Strong presentation skills to effectively communicate findings to senior management.
Interpersonal Skills:
Ability to work collaboratively with site teams and senior management.
Strong negotiation and conflict resolution skills.
Cultural sensitivity and ability to work in diverse environments.
Personal Skills
Strong commitment to ethical standards and integrity
Ability to hold people accountable
Healthy curiosity to get the bottom of issues
Organizational Skills:
Strong project management skills.
Ability to manage multiple audits and prioritize tasks effectively.
Self-motivated and able to work independently with minimal supervision.
Professional Qualifications:
Degree qualified in Occupational Health and Safety, Environmental Science, Engineering or a related field.
Relevant certifications (e.g., Certified Safety Professional (CSP), Certified Industrial Hygienist (CIH), ISO 45001 Lead Auditor, ISO 14001 Lead Auditor) are highly desirable.
Experience in SHE, Auditing, Engineering or a related field.
Additional Requirements:
Willingness to travel extensively (up to 50% of the time).
Proficiency in using audit management software and tools.
